Understanding the Role of the Clerk of the Court of Common Pleas
Alright, let's start with the basics. The Clerk of the Court of Common Pleas is basically the gatekeeper of all legal records in Lucas County. This office handles everything from civil cases to criminal trials, making sure every document is filed correctly and every process runs smoothly. It's like the conductor of a symphony, ensuring everything stays in harmony within the judicial system.
But what exactly does the clerk do? Well, they're responsible for maintaining accurate records, managing court calendars, and even assisting with jury duty logistics. Think of them as the ultimate multitaskers in the world of law. Plus, they play a key role in ensuring public access to court information, which is a big deal for transparency and accountability.
Key Responsibilities of the Clerk
Here's a quick rundown of the main duties:
- Managing court filings and records
- Issuing marriage licenses and other legal documents
- Overseeing jury selection processes
- Coordinating with judges and attorneys
